Three weeks have already passed since Enzo had the fatal landing after trying to jump what looked like a simple 60 cm high wall on the side of him and that on the other had a 10 meters high drop.
We can say that Enzo was born again just 3 weeks ago.
Today the veterinary traumatologist has removed the splints and the bandage, leaving his two anterior surgery-corrected legs exposed despite still inflamed.

Believe it or not, Enzo has been able to walk very carefully and it seems that his legs support well although he does not risk taking long walks and immediately looks for a good soft corner to lie down.

IMG_7781.jpg

The vet has advised me to avoid visiting the dog area for at least a week, we do not want some careless play with other dogs that could harm the healing, that is, we will have to rest for some more time.
Afterwards, the goal will be to lengthen the walks as Enzo feels less pain and gradually decrease the pain relievers to zero.
Let's hope that in a few weeks Enzo can lead a more normal life ... and so will I 😅
